cryptospore / rpms / qemu-kvm

Forked from rpms/qemu-kvm 2 years ago
Clone
9ae3a8
From 7062c4cd0e110af1bbf165db42c11ca2cbb50fc1 Mon Sep 17 00:00:00 2001
9ae3a8
From: =?UTF-8?q?Marc-Andr=C3=A9=20Lureau?= <marcandre.lureau@redhat.com>
9ae3a8
Date: Thu, 4 Jan 2018 20:19:02 +0100
9ae3a8
Subject: [PATCH 1/2] i386: update ssdt-misc.hex.generated
9ae3a8
MIME-Version: 1.0
9ae3a8
Content-Type: text/plain; charset=UTF-8
9ae3a8
Content-Transfer-Encoding: 8bit
9ae3a8
9ae3a8
RH-Author: Marc-André Lureau <marcandre.lureau@redhat.com>
9ae3a8
Message-id: <20180104201902.4364-1-marcandre.lureau@redhat.com>
9ae3a8
Patchwork-id: 78516
9ae3a8
O-Subject: [RHEL-7.5 qemu-kvm PATCH] i386: update ssdt-misc.hex.generated
9ae3a8
Bugzilla: 1411490
9ae3a8
RH-Acked-by: Michael S. Tsirkin <mst@redhat.com>
9ae3a8
RH-Acked-by: Laszlo Ersek <lersek@redhat.com>
9ae3a8
RH-Acked-by: Igor Mammedov <imammedo@redhat.com>
9ae3a8
9ae3a8
RHEL commit d7b246e19d4e81f231b3aff6c3885c325be9a9d2 "i386: expose
9ae3a8
fw_cfg QEMU0002 in SSDT" modified ssdt-misc.dsl to export fw_cfg in
9ae3a8
ACPI tables. However, the file isn't compiled in RHEL.
9ae3a8
9ae3a8
Use known good version acpica-tools-20150619-3.el7.x86_64 to build the
9ae3a8
new compiled version. I verified with a RHEL5 guest that #1377087
9ae3a8
isn't happening again after this update.
9ae3a8
9ae3a8
RHEL only: This is needed so kernel module can find the device and
9ae3a8
load the driver. Upstream qemu uses different API to build ACPI
9ae3a8
tables.
9ae3a8
9ae3a8
Signed-off-by: Marc-André Lureau <marcandre.lureau@redhat.com>
9ae3a8
Signed-off-by: Miroslav Rezanina <mrezanin@redhat.com>
9ae3a8
---
9ae3a8
 hw/i386/ssdt-misc.hex.generated | 68 ++++++++++++++++++++++++++++++++++++++---
9ae3a8
 1 file changed, 64 insertions(+), 4 deletions(-)
9ae3a8
9ae3a8
diff --git a/hw/i386/ssdt-misc.hex.generated b/hw/i386/ssdt-misc.hex.generated
9ae3a8
index 86c5725..52ad0b7 100644
9ae3a8
--- a/hw/i386/ssdt-misc.hex.generated
9ae3a8
+++ b/hw/i386/ssdt-misc.hex.generated
9ae3a8
@@ -18,12 +18,12 @@ static unsigned char ssdp_misc_aml[] = {
9ae3a8
 0x53,
9ae3a8
 0x44,
9ae3a8
 0x54,
9ae3a8
-0x62,
9ae3a8
+0x9e,
9ae3a8
 0x1,
9ae3a8
 0x0,
9ae3a8
 0x0,
9ae3a8
 0x1,
9ae3a8
-0x80,
9ae3a8
+0xbf,
9ae3a8
 0x42,
9ae3a8
 0x58,
9ae3a8
 0x50,
9ae3a8
@@ -176,6 +176,66 @@ static unsigned char ssdp_misc_aml[] = {
9ae3a8
 0x0,
9ae3a8
 0x0,
9ae3a8
 0x10,
9ae3a8
+0x3b,
9ae3a8
+0x5c,
9ae3a8
+0x2e,
9ae3a8
+0x5f,
9ae3a8
+0x53,
9ae3a8
+0x42,
9ae3a8
+0x5f,
9ae3a8
+0x50,
9ae3a8
+0x43,
9ae3a8
+0x49,
9ae3a8
+0x30,
9ae3a8
+0x5b,
9ae3a8
+0x82,
9ae3a8
+0x2e,
9ae3a8
+0x46,
9ae3a8
+0x57,
9ae3a8
+0x43,
9ae3a8
+0x46,
9ae3a8
+0x8,
9ae3a8
+0x5f,
9ae3a8
+0x48,
9ae3a8
+0x49,
9ae3a8
+0x44,
9ae3a8
+0xd,
9ae3a8
+0x51,
9ae3a8
+0x45,
9ae3a8
+0x4d,
9ae3a8
+0x55,
9ae3a8
+0x30,
9ae3a8
+0x30,
9ae3a8
+0x30,
9ae3a8
+0x32,
9ae3a8
+0x0,
9ae3a8
+0x8,
9ae3a8
+0x5f,
9ae3a8
+0x53,
9ae3a8
+0x54,
9ae3a8
+0x41,
9ae3a8
+0xa,
9ae3a8
+0xb,
9ae3a8
+0x8,
9ae3a8
+0x5f,
9ae3a8
+0x43,
9ae3a8
+0x52,
9ae3a8
+0x53,
9ae3a8
+0x11,
9ae3a8
+0xd,
9ae3a8
+0xa,
9ae3a8
+0xa,
9ae3a8
+0x47,
9ae3a8
+0x1,
9ae3a8
+0x10,
9ae3a8
+0x5,
9ae3a8
+0x10,
9ae3a8
+0x5,
9ae3a8
+0x1,
9ae3a8
+0xc,
9ae3a8
+0x79,
9ae3a8
+0x0,
9ae3a8
+0x10,
9ae3a8
 0x40,
9ae3a8
 0xc,
9ae3a8
 0x5c,
9ae3a8
@@ -369,8 +429,8 @@ static unsigned char ssdp_misc_aml[] = {
9ae3a8
 0x4d,
9ae3a8
 0x58
9ae3a8
 };
9ae3a8
-static unsigned char ssdt_isa_pest[] = {
9ae3a8
-0xd0
9ae3a8
+static unsigned short ssdt_isa_pest[] = {
9ae3a8
+0x10c
9ae3a8
 };
9ae3a8
 static unsigned char acpi_s4_name[] = {
9ae3a8
 0x88
9ae3a8
-- 
9ae3a8
1.8.3.1
9ae3a8